1-Methyl-4-nitro-1H-imidazole-5-carboxylic Acid is a versatile compound widely used in chemical synthesis for its unique properties and reactivity. In organic synthesis, this specific compound serves as a key building block for creating various p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, and advanced materials. Its nitro and carboxylic acid functional groups make it a valuable intermediate for introducing specific functionalities or structural motifs into target molecules. Additionally, its imidazole ring provides opportunities for creating heterocyclic systems, which are commonly found in biologically active compounds. Due to its potent chemical reactivity and flexibility in molecular design, 1-Methyl-4-nitro-1H-imidazole-5-carboxylic Acid plays a crucial role in the development of new synthetic routes and the production of complex molecules with tailored properties.
